The .300 HAM'R, conceived by Bill Wilson of Wilson Combat, represents an evolutionary leap beyond the .300 AAC Blackout cartridge, delivering enhanced range, accuracy, and terminal effectiveness.

Constructed on a modified .223 Remington cartridge case, the .300 HAM'R expands to embrace a .308 caliber bullet. It accommodates a diverse array of bullet weights, ranging from 110 to 150 grains, achieving muzzle velocities reaching up to 2,400 feet per second. This cartridge prioritizes superior precision, high muzzle velocity, and extended-range performance while preserving manageable recoil and exceptional terminal ballistics.

The .300 HAM'R finds its niche in hunting applications, particularly for medium to large game like deer and wild hogs, as well as tactical scenarios. It also enjoys popularity among sharpshooters and precision rifle competitors, drawn to its outstanding accuracy and ballistics performance. One notable advantage over the .300 AAC Blackout is its capacity to deliver energy at greater distances. Moreover, its compatibility with standard AR-15 magazines and lower receivers makes it an ideal choice for AR-15 rifles.
